Melaleuca

1. Pour the flour into the basin, first use boiling water and part of the flour, and then use cold water to mix the flour into a dough. Let stand for about 20 minutes.

2. Chop green onions, add chopped green onions, minced ginger, light soy sauce, dark soy sauce, oyster sauce, salt, and stir well.

3. Divide the live dough into two, take one and roll it into a thin rectangular dough.

4. Spread a layer of minced meat and leave blank on all sides.

5. Roll up from bottom to top, pinch the edges tightly, and slowly roll into a cake.

6. Pour the right amount of cooking oil evenly into the pan, and add the meatloaf when it is 50% hot. Bake until both sides are golden and mature.
